SPI Supplies® YAG/YAP Comparison Table

Compare the properties of these two outstanding scintillator materials


YAGYAP
Physical Properties:
Density (g/cm3)4.575.37
Hardness (Mho) 8.58.6
Index of refraction 1.821.95
Crystal structure CubicRhombic
Melting point, °C 19701875
Hygroscopic No No
Linear coefficient of thermal expansion, 10-5/K 0.8-0.90.4-1.1
Cleavage NoNo
Chemical formula Y3Al5O12YAlO3



Luminescence properties:
Integrated light output (%NaI: Ti) 15 40
Wavelength of maximum emission (nm) 550 370
Decay constant, ns 70 25
After glow (% at 6 ms) <0.005 <0.005
Radiation length (cm) 3.5 2.7
Photon yield at 300 °K (103 Ph/MeV) 8 10
